N727 CWR is a 1995 Mercedes-benz 208 D in White with a 2,300c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 54.5%.
Across all 1995 Mercedes-benz 208 D models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.2% with a typical mileage of 142,201 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z 208 D f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 7,461 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N727 CWR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z 208 D typ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 31 years old, this Mercedes-benz 208 D is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
